How to Fix Samsung Washing Machine Error UE
Error UE (uE) means the machine detected an unbalanced load during the spin cycle. The drum cannot spin at high RPM safely because laundry is lumped to one side.

Step-by-step fix
- 1
Step 1
Pause and wait
Press Pause/Start. Wait 2 minutes for the door lock to release.
- 2
Step 2
Open and redistribute
Open the door. Pull out any bunched-up items (usually bedsheets, jeans, or towels). Spread them evenly around the drum.
Pro tip: If only one heavy item is in the drum (e.g., a single pair of jeans), add a few light items to balance the weight.
- 3
Step 3
Check for overloading
Samsung front-loaders have a max-load rating printed inside the door. If you're above 75% of that rating with heavy fabrics, remove a few items.
- 4
Step 4
Close and resume
Close the door firmly. Press Start. The cycle should resume without UE.
- 5
Step 5
If it recurs
Check the machine is on a level surface. Use a spirit level on top — if it's tilted more than 2°, adjust the feet.
When to call a technician
- • UE appears on every cycle even with evenly distributed small loads
- • You hear banging during spin (likely broken suspension rods)
- • The machine has shifted position on the floor during cycles
Frequently asked questions
Why does my Samsung washing machine keep showing UE?
Usually an uneven load — bunched bedsheets or a single heavy item. Less often, the machine is not level on the floor.
How do I balance a front-load washing machine?
Use a spirit level on top. If tilted, rotate the levelling feet at the bottom corners until level. Lock with the counter-nut.
Can UE damage the machine?
Yes if ignored. Repeated high-RPM attempts with an unbalanced load stresses the suspension and bearings, leading to expensive repairs.
